Nutella Pancakes
- Total Time: 15
- Yield: 10 1x
Ingredients
Scale- 150g self-raising flour
- 30g sugar
- 1 teas vanilla bean paste
- 50g nutella
- 250mls milk
- 1 egg
Instructions
- Place everything into bowl.
- Blitz on speed 5 until combined.
- In a frying pan over medium heat, melt a little coconut oil or butter and fry small dallops of the mixture. Once bubbles appear on the surface it’s time to flip them over. They will only take 30 seconds on this side.
Notes
- If your mix is too dry for your liking add some more milk to it.
- Prep Time: 5
- Cook Time: 10
